Glow plug flashing intermittentaly

Post by maxx007at »

I get that, but only the flashing glowplug doesn’t tell you what the problem is.
Since that is used for showing that there is any problem related to the ECU, you’ll need to hook up diagnosis first before you can start solving it.

Otherwise you could be changing glowplugs, wiringlooms, etc only to find out it was a failing sensor of a few quid

Re: Glow plug flashing intermittentaly

Post by Doc »

Underboost (Control range not reached) and the brake switch implausible signal will likely both need resolved and either one may have brought on the flashing glow plug light.
Searching the internet can lead you down many dark roads if you don't know what you are looking for, the brake switch fault is a common cause of cruise control failure which often times is a driver's first indication of a problem with the switch.

Re: Glow plug flashing intermittentaly

Post by Doc »

Underboost is maybe a blocked filter, leaking boost pipes or a faulty turbo.
